What is the object of the prepositional phrase in the sentence Charlotte and Kate had a picnic at the park yesterday

Respuesta :

firebug05
firebug05 firebug05
  • 23-10-2020

Answer:

Park

Explanation:

The object of a prepositional phrase is the "what" or "whom" of the phrase. In this sentence, "park" answers the question of where the picnic was at. The noun, pronoun, or gerund following the preposition will always be the object.
